Understanding SaaS Cost Models: A Guide

Choosing the right rate model for your Software as a Platform can feel overwhelming. Various approaches exist, each with its own pros and drawbacks. Typical selections include free, where a limited edition is offered for free to attract users, layered rate, which presents multiple packages with escalating features at rising prices, and usage-based pricing, where clients only pay for what they use. Furthermore, individual rate charges clients based on the number of engaged users accessing the software, while performance-based rate aligns the charge with the outcome delivered. Carefully evaluate your ideal market, business goals, and competitive landscape to determine the optimal appropriate framework for your SaaS offering.

Key SaaS Protection Best Practices

Maintaining robust Cloud saas security requires a multi-faceted approach. It’s no longer sufficient to simply rely on the provider's inherent controls. Regular vulnerability assessments and penetration evaluation are vital to proactively uncover potential risks. Implementing multi-factor authorization across all profiles is essential, and information should be consistently encrypted both in motion and at storage. User awareness on social engineering prevention, alongside stringent access management – restricting what each employee can access – forms an significant aspect of a secure SaaS safeguarding framework. Consider also implementing thorough monitoring capabilities for rapid detection of suspicious activity.
